英文摘要
This research aims to reduce energy consumption in a certain region by optimizing air-conditioning based on fine-grained environmental information delivered in real-time. In order to collect environmental information at low cost, we studied various sensing techniques such as participatory sensing which utilizes smartphones of users as sensors, sensing from social media texts, sensing by an animal-wearable device. We also developed a privacy-preserving scheme for participatory sensing by using a combination of negative surveys and randomized response techniques. Finally we developed a home automation system that controls various home appliances including air-conditioner based on the analysis of sensor data from multiple information sources. Overall, we studied the whole story of energy management from acquisition of environmental data to the control of air-conditioner based on the analysis of the sensing data.
